A report on generation of a continuous variable Einstein-Podolsky-Rosen (EPR) entanglement was presented using an optical fiber interferometer. Two independent squeezed beams were generated using Kerr nonlinearity. ERP entanglement was obtained between the output beams. Correlation of amplitude quadratures was measured below the quantum noise limit.
